Overview

We are looking for a highly organized and detail-focused Analyst for the Client Success Team specializing in relationship management. The role involves overseeing the entire client onboarding workflow and delivering professional, timely, and precise service to both clients and internal partners.

Key Responsibilities

  • Serve as a member of a global team focusing on Capital Markets onboarding requests from North American clients and sales desks.
  • Coordinate client lifecycle requests for new and existing clients across multiple functional groups including KYC, AML, Legal, Operations, IT, Credit, Documentation, and Risk to ensure seamless client and sales experiences.
  • Update and maintain onboarding status reports to keep business stakeholders informed, escalating issues to meet client deadlines and expectations.
  • Detect and escalate operational control incidents, supporting the resolution of operational deficiencies, unauthorized trading, and risk loss events.
  • Ensure adherence to banking policies related to onboarding including KYC, risk management, and regulatory requirements.
  • Provide additional business support such as involvement in strategic or regulatory projects, policy and procedure documentation, and reporting as assigned by management.
  • Identify and propose process improvements to enhance efficiency and automate workflows.
